> When we rerun the executable after changing its source files,
> GDB would re-set all previously set breakpoints. The
> breakpoints set to the function names would remain at their initial
> locations. But the breakpoints which used filename:line notation would
> be silently shifted following the source code changes.
>
> To address this, GDB now optionally captures a small window of source
> code lines around each breakpoint set with filename:line notation,
> when it is first set. When the binary is reloaded, GDB detects the BFD
> change and tries to locate the same source context in the new file,
> and if successful, re-sets the breakpoint to the matched source code
> line.
>
> The breakpoint_source structure stores captured source code lines
> around a breakpoint location, along with a reference to the BFD
> that was current when the source was captured.
>
> When source tracking is enabled (via 'set breakpoint source-tracking
> enabled on'), GDB captures 3 lines of source context
> (BREAKPOINT_SRC_CTX_LINES) along with the current BFD when a
> breakpoint is first set.  On executable reload (detected by comparing
> BFDs), it searches within a 12-line window
> (BREAKPOINT_SRC_CTX_LINES * BREAKPOINT_SRC_SEARCH_MULTIPLIER) for
> the best match and adjusts the breakpoint location if needed.
>
> If source tracking is disabled after breakpoints have been tracked,
> all existing source tracking information is discarded and a message
> is printed.

> Limitations of the current implementation:
>
> Source tracking is not enabled for pending breakpoints that become
> non-pending.  When a breakpoint is created pending (e.g. with 'set
> breakpoint pending on'), source context is not captured at creation
> time since no symtab is available yet.  When the breakpoint later
> resolves to a location, re_set_default() only updates existing tracked
> breakpoints and does not initiate tracking for newly resolved ones.
> This could be fixed in the future by initiating source tracking in
> re_set_default() when a breakpoint transitions from pending to
> non-pending.
>
> Source tracking for ranged breakpoints is not currently supported.
> Ranged breakpoints have a start and end location spec, and tracking
> both independently raises questions about whether to preserve the
> range length or track each end separately.  For now, ranged
> breakpoints will never be source-tracked.

> +@cindex source-tracking breakpoints
> +@cindex breakpoints, automatic adjustment when source changes
> +@value{GDBN} supports @dfn{source-tracking breakpoints}, which
> +automatically adjust their location when source code changes between
> +recompilations.  When enabled with @code{set breakpoint source-tracking
> +enabled on}, breakpoints set by file and line number capture a small
> +window of surrounding source lines: the line immediately before the
> +breakpoint, the breakpoint line itself, and the line immediately after
> +it.  If the source file is modified and the executable is rebuilt,
> +@value{GDBN} searches a window of approximately 12 lines centered on the
> +breakpoint's original position for a match.  A candidate line is
> +accepted when it matches the captured breakpoint line and both of
> +its immediate neighbors also match, reducing false positives from
> +short or repeated lines.  @value{GDBN} uses the first such confirmed
> +match found, scanning from the top of the search window.  If the same
> +code sequence appears more than once within the search window, the
> +earliest occurrence is chosen; code outside the search window is not
> +considered.  If no match is found, @value{GDBN} issues a warning and
> +keeps the breakpoint at its original location, disabling source tracking
> +for that breakpoint.  Note that breakpoints set by function name or
> +address are not affected by source tracking.  @xref{Set Breaks}.
